Changes in land use of the Krkonoše Mts. and the Hrubý Jeseník Mts. alpine treeless: a summary of the current state of knowledge and a comparison of historical development
Alpine treeless is a unique phenomenon in Czechia occupying the largest area in the Krkonoše Mts. and the Hrubý Jeseník Mts. Since the time of colonization, the landscape of the alpine treeless in both mountain ranges has experienced a turbulent development that has been variable in space and time. The aim of the article is to compare the development of land use of the alpine treeless in the Krkonoše Mts. and the Hrubý Jeseník Mts. and the driving forces that caused the changes there, through a literature search. The results show a lack of studies focused on the development of land use in the Hrubý Jeseník Mts. The biggest differences in the land use of both mountain ranges started in the seventeenth century, when the phenomenon of so called “huts farming” came to the Krkonoše Mts. as the main driving force. This phenomenon prevailed in the Hrubý Jeseník Mts. much later and only very sporadically and locally. Other driving forces of landscape change are mining, deforestation, afforestation, and tourism.
